Blitz Academy logo
Tulsa, OK

Blitz United Soccer Club (BUSC) is a youth soccer organization based in Tulsa, Oklahoma. The club focuses on developing young athletes through various programs and competitive opportunities. Blitz United offers specialized training, including individualized sessions, to enhance player skills. The club fields teams that compete in top-tier leagues, specifically the ECNL Regional League for both boys and girls. A significant achievement for the club is winning the 2024 USYS National President's Cup. Blitz United also maintains a notable partnership with FC Tulsa, a professional soccer club. The club provides programs for different age groups, including its Academy FC Juniors and AFC Elite Academy, catering to the development of youth players.

Northeast Oklahoma Futball Club (NEOFC) is a non-profit youth soccer organization serving the Northeast Oklahoma region. The club is dedicated to providing a high level of instruction to committed soccer players, preparing them for local, state, and regional competitions. NEOFC aims to develop confident players who achieve their full athletic potential and become active community members. While specific establishment dates are not provided, the club emphasizes improving soccer opportunities for players at all levels of interest and ability, positioning itself as a major destination club for the area. NEOFC offers programs for various age groups, including Academy for U7-U10 players and Competitive for U11-U19 players, focusing on technical, tactical, physical, and psychological development. The club's competitive teams participate in leagues such as the National League Frontier Conference, with opportunities for qualification into Premier I.

West Side Alliance logo
Sand Springs, OK

West Side Alliance Soccer Club (WSA) is a prominent youth soccer organization based in Oklahoma, with headquarters in Tulsa and divisions across the state, including the Greater Tulsa Metro area and Oklahoma City. Established in 1992, WSA operates as a non-profit service organization dedicated to fostering personal development and nurturing children through soccer. The club distinguishes itself with a professional coaching staff, including over 15 college coaches and approximately 70 nationally licensed coaches, and offers one of the most generous financial assistance programs in the United States. WSA has a proven track record of developing elite youth competitive teams, achieving numerous state championships, regional and national rankings, and facilitating hundreds of college placements and professional player placements. They offer comprehensive programming for ages 2-19, encompassing recreational, academy, and competitive levels. Their competitive teams participate in top leagues such as Oklahoma Premier Clubs (OPC), Elite Club National League - Regional League (ECNL-RL), USYS Frontier Conference, and USL's Super Y League. Additionally, WSA includes semi-professional men's and women's teams, Side FC 92 OKC, which competes in the Women's Premier Soccer League (WPSL). The club is expanding its competitive offerings, with its girls' teams joining the Elite Clubs National League (ECNL) for the 2025-26 season and the club joining USL-Y for the 2025 summer season.

Sheffield United Soccer Club operates in the Tulsa, Oklahoma area, serving youth players in the local community. Established in 1978 following the immigration of its founding family from England, the club has built a strong foundation in competitive youth soccer development. It caters to boys and girls across various age groups, with a focus on ages 6 through 11 in its core academy programs. The club emphasizes a smooth transition from recreational to competitive play, creating an environment that fosters technical, tactical, and functional skills alongside ethics, perseverance, and sportsmanship. Unique features include a pooled player training model executed by qualified professionals and talent identification nights to scout and develop potential. The Rise Academy program maximizes player potential through specialized coaching for younger athletes, preparing them for higher levels of competition. Teams participate in regional tournaments such as the NEOFC Kick-Off, where they have achieved finalist status in recent years. The club supports ongoing player development through seasonal tryouts, schedules, and facilities like the Bixby Keas Soccer Complex, promoting long-term growth in the sport.
